Deforestation has caused some bad effects on the environment, animals, and people. Because of the depletion of the forest there is an increase in greenhouse gasses that causes global warming, a lot of animals are now endangered, and the supply for needs of people decreases. In this manner, there is a significant increase in the demand for reforestation around the world especially in the Philippines. This is the restoration of the forests and woodlands that has been severely depleted. When the rebuilding is successful, there are surely a lot of benefits that it can offer. It will help the environment and the animals as well as the people living in the area. It will keep these people safe from soil erosion and flood.

When it comes to this type of project, it requires seedlings taken from the area so that majority that grows there will be the trees and plants that have been there before. Multiple species are planted as well to cater the needs of other species that will be living there when all the trees have grown. The project also considers that there will be natural regeneration of different types of plants. In this manner, they make sure that the trees that they will plant on the area will really be compatible with soil and the climate.

Reforestation is carefully planned out to avoid any problems in the future or even while the project is ongoing. Spacing on plants and trees should be accurate so that it will not overlap each other while they grow. It may cover other plants which will cause it to die eventually. It is also considered to use native species of plants and tress which is very much beneficial because it will surely survive. This helps the restoration of the soil and rejuvenation of local flora and fauna.
